We didn't need Jon Stewart to tell us how silly it is for Washington to threaten our economy with another downgrade. We need him to show us how silly this whole thing is making the rest of us. Stewart can't tell what's dumber: the fact that this whole fiscal-cliff scenario is completely a man-made thing — an asteroid thing — that America has inflicted upon itself, or the news anchors, what with their blowing on embers and their slapping on of "-ageddon" or "-calypse" to the end of whatever name they're calling it today.
